Evelyn Halen
December 22, 1916 ~ September 16, 2007
Served by: Luce, Luze & Reck Funeral Homes
Evelyn B. Halen, 90, of Miller and formerly of Wessington, died Sunday, September 16, 2007 at the Miller Good Samaritan Center.
Funeral services were held at 10:30a.m., Thursday, September 20, 2007 at the Reck Funeral Home, Miller, with Rev. Allen Sager officiating. Burial was in the Wessington Cemetery. Visitation was 4:00-8:00p.m., Wednesday, September 19 at the Reck Funeral Home in Miller.
Evelyn was born December 22, 1916 in Vananda, MT to Maurice and Minnie (Croes) Crossman. Her father died shortly after her birth.
She was the last living family member of her generation and she will be greatly missed.
She is survived by an adopted brother Maurice Hain, Great Falls, MT; daughter, Barbara Wolfe, Reedsburg, Wisconsin; son and daughter-in-law Craig and Mary Halen, Maple Grove, MN; grandson, Derek Halen, Maple Grove, MN; granddaughter Kim Wolfe and great-grandchildren Jacob Grooms, Juliann Grooms and Kelsie Graves, North Freedom, WI; cousin Luella Schultz (Crossman), who was with her near the end of her life, and her husband Casey Schultz, Miller, SD; and other nieces and nephews.
She was preceded by her mother, Minnie Hain; stepfather, Jacob Hain; and beloved husband, Cap Halen, who passed in 1986 after more than 45 years of marriage. She was also preceded by sister’s Marion Saylor, Rosalyn Etem, Irma Dobler and Myrtle Miles who she greatly missed.
Memorials are preferred to the Miller Good Samaritan Center; Avera St. Lukes North Plains Hospice and volunteers; or the American Cancer Society.
